All functions are registered using the NAT v1.2.1 pattern:
@register_function(config_type=GridOptimizeToolConfig)
async def grid_optimize(tool_config: GridOptimizeToolConfig, builder: Builder):
async def _grid_optimize(region: str = "default") -> str:
# Implementation
...
yield FunctionInfo.from_fn(
_grid_optimize,
description="Optimizes power grid configuration..."
)# Run unit tests

export OPENAI_API_KEY="your-key"If you have old code using aiq imports:
- Replace
aiqwithnatin imports - Update
pyproject.tomlentry points fromaiq.componentstonat.components - Add
nvidia-nat[langchain]~=1.2.1to dependencies - Update Python version requirement to
>=3.11,<3.14
